Japan Inc makes a renewed U.S. push as China fears mount

==========

Japanese companies are increasingly focusing on the United States as concerns about Chinese demand and Beijing's influence over supply chains grow. Companies such as Yaskawa Electric, Asahi, Renesas Electronics, and Honda have expressed interest in expanding in the U.S. or have announced plans to do so. While Japan remains tied to China through trade and manufacturing operations, Tokyo has pledged to limit supply-chain exposure to China. The caution is due to economic security risks, pessimism about Chinese demand, and a weakening economy. Japanese automakers are particularly interested in the U.S. market as their sales decline in China. Toyota plans to boost investment in its EV battery plant in North Carolina, while Honda will invest in transforming its Ohio plants into an EV hub. However, Japan Inc remains heavily reliant on China as a manufacturing base and market. Last year, mainland China was Japan's largest source of imports and its second-largest export market. The United States was its top export market. Some companies see the U.S. market as a better long-term option, while others are unable to leave the Chinese market due to their reliance on it.
